Robberies on Statia reported.
Loading...

On SaturdayJuly 21st around 4.05 am there was a notification of a stolen quad. The owner parked the quad at the airport on Sint Eustatius around 11.30 pm on the evening of Friday the 20th of July and when he returned at 4am the quad had been taken.
On Sunday July 22nd around 1.30 am there was a notifiaction of intended break-in in a house on Samuel A Charles street on Saba. The suspect tried to enter the bedroom of the homeowner by climbing into the window. The windows were not locked. When the owner of the house woke up the suspect ran away. Nothing has been taken.

KPCN Press Release
